@charset "UTF-8";
/* チュートリアル新投稿おしらせ部分のスタイル */
.new {
  width: 100%;
  /* height: 254px; */
  left: 513.46px;
  top: 302.46px;
  padding: 15px;
  background: #FFFFFF;
  border: 1px solid #979797;
  border-radius: 8px;
}
.new header {
  display: flex;
  padding: 0 0 15px 0;
  border-bottom: 1px dotted;
  color: #000;
}

header {
  display: flex;
  padding: 0 0 15px 0;
  border-bottom: 1px dotted;
}

.new header h3 {
  padding: 0;
  margin: 0;
  font-weight: bold;
}

.new header h3 img {
  margin-right: 10px;
  vertical-align: bottom;
}

.new header span {
  display: block;
  margin: 0 0 0 auto;
  font-size: 0.9em;
}

.new a {
  padding: 0;
  text-decoration: underline;
  color: #008edc;
  display: table; /*span間の隙間を削除*/
}

.new a:hover {
  opacity: 0.8;
}

.new ul {
  padding-top: 10px;
}

.new ul li {
  padding: 10px 0;
  border-bottom: 1px dotted;
}

.new ul li:nth-child(1) {
  padding-top: 0;
}

.new ul li a span {
  padding: 0;
  display: inline-block; /*NEWと日づけの下のtext-decorationを非表示*/
}

.new ul li a span:nth-child(1) {
  font-size: 0.5em;
  background-color: #dc143c;
  color: #fff;
  border-radius: 4px;
  padding: 2px 5px;
  margin-right: 10px;
}

.new ul li a span:nth-child(2) {
  color: #000;
}

.new ul li a span:nth-child(2)::after {
  white-space: pre-wrap;
  content: "  ";
}/*# sourceMappingURL=tutorial_new.css.map */